Basic safety precautions must be observed when using electrical devices. To avoid the
danger of burns, electric shocks, fires and/or personal injury, please carefully read
through this instruction manual before using the device for the first time and observe
all instructions when using the device.
Please keep this instruction manual in a safe place for future reference.
When this device is passed on to another person, please also supply this instruction
manual with the device.

• Only connect the device to a plug that has been installed in accordance with regulations. Do not
use any desk socket or extension cable.
• The voltage specified on the nameplate of the device must correspond to that of your mains
supply.
• Be careful that there is no risk of the power cord causing a trip hazard during operation of the
device.
• Be careful that there is no risk of the device itself becoming a trip hazard during operation.
• Keep the device, power cord and mains plug away from hot surfaces and naked flames as well as
from sharp edges. Be careful during operation to ensure that the cable does not become jammed
(e.g. in doors).
• Never touch the device, power cord and mains plug with moist or wet hands.
• Never immerse the device, power cord and mains plug in water or other liquids. There is a risk of
fatal electric shock!
• When you pull out the plug, always grip the plug and never the cable.
• The device is only intended for use in living areas. Do not use it in damp locations or outside.
• Do not use the device near sources of hear or naked flames.
• Never leave the device unsupervised when in operation or when plugged into the mains.
• Do not prop the device on people or animals. Risk of injury!
• Be careful during operation to ensure no hair, loose clothing or body part comes in the vicinity of
the rotor blades or other moving parts.
• Do not use the device in a location where there is an open fire e.g. fireplace), naked flames (e.g.
candles), flammable gases, liquids or dust. Risk of explosion and fire!
